Sec. 405.001. ACCOUNTING AND DISTRIBUTION.
(a)In addition to or in lieu of the right to an accounting provided by Section 404.001 , at any time after the expiration of two years after the date the court clerk first issues letters testamentary or of administration to any personal representative of an estate, a person interested in the estate then subject to independent administration may petition the court for an accounting and distribution. The court may order an accounting to be made with the court by the independent executor at such time as the court considers proper. The accounting shall include the information that the court considers necessary to determine whether any part of the estate should be distributed.
